Skip to content

Commit 713cb17

Browse files
committed
Deploy tagged images to registry
1 parent cb9333a commit 713cb17

File tree

1 file changed

+10
-0
lines changed

1 file changed

+10
-0
lines changed

.gitlab-ci.yml

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@ image: docker:dind
33
variables:
44
CONTAINER_TEST_IMAGE: "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G"
55
CONTAINER_RELEASE_IMAGE: "$CI_REGISTRY_IMAGE:latest"
6+
CONTAINER_TAGGED_IMAGE: "$C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ME"
67

78
stages:
89
- build
@@ -26,3 +27,12 @@ release-image:
2627
- docker push "$CONTAINER_RELEASE_IMAGE"
2728
only:
2829
- master
30+
31+
tagged-image:
32+
stage: release
33+
script:
34+
- docker pull "$CONTAINER_TEST_IMAGE"
35+
- docker tag "$CONTAINER_TEST_IMAGE" "$CONTAINER_TAGGED_IMAGE"
36+
- docker push "$CONTAINER_TAGGED_IMAGE"
37+
only:
38+
- tags

0 commit comments

Comments
 (0)